Isabella Stewart Gardner Museum (ISGM)

The Isabella Stewart Gardner Museum is a unique museum that features a collection of art and artifacts from around the world. The museum's collection includes works by artists such as Titian, Raphael, and Rembrandt. The museum is also known for its beautiful gardens and architecture. Location: 25 Evans Way, Boston, MA 02115, telephone: 617-566-1401


Museum of Fine Arts (MFA)

The MFA is one of the most comprehensive art museums in the world. It has a collection of more than 450,000 works of art, including paintings, sculptures, prints, drawings, textiles, and decorative arts. The museum's collection includes works by artists such as Monet, Van Gogh, Rembrandt, and Degas. Location: 465 Huntington Avenue, Boston, MA 02115, telephone: 617-267-9300
